Manager – IT BASE
Information Technology
Position Summary:
The Manager of IT Business Alignment and Strategic Engagement (BASE) serves as a strategic partner to business leaders and a key interface between the business and IT delivery teams. This role is responsible for understanding business needs, shaping and prioritizing technology demand, and translating business challenges into clearly defined, value-driven initiatives that align with enterprise strategy. The role leads a small team focused on solution definition, intake, and prioritization to ensure technology investments deliver measurable business value.
Outline of Duties:
- Partner with business leaders to understand strategies, goals, and challenges and identify technology-enabled opportunities.
- Shape and manage demand for enterprise technology solutions, ensuring alignment with organizational priorities.
- Translating business needs into clearly scoped, prioritized, and deliverable initiatives.
- Guide strategic prioritization and advise on resource allocation to maximize business value and ROI.
- Participate in technology governance to ensure decisions reflect validated business priorities.
- Lead evaluation and selection of business-critical systems, including vendor engagement and implementation planning.
- Serve as a bridge between business stakeholders and IT delivery teams, ensuring clear requirements and effective handoff for execution.
- Promote a strong focus on business value, outcomes, and return on technology investments.
- Provide direction, mentorship, and supervision to the BASE team. This involves guiding their work, setting goals, and ensuring their professional growth.
- All other duties as assigned.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, related field, or equivalent combination of relevant experience and education
- 5-7 years of experience in data analytics development or data engineering, with experience in leadership and supervision.
Desired Qualifications:
- Master’s degree in computer science, engineering, or related field
